<em>New Zealand Tablet</em> editorial

The New Zealand Tabletwas a Catholic newspaper produced under the auspices of Bishop Patrick Moran of Dunedin. Moran campaigned tirelessly against the denial of state funding to Catholic primary schools under the Education Act 1877. This editorial was published repeatedly in the Tablet until 1897.
